Hallo,
erst mal die Fakten:
1. Welche Hardware? LarsP
2. Welche Hardwareversion? Peter Sieg
3. Welche Firmware? Unseen
4. Welche Firmwareversion? sd2iec 0.10.2
5. Stromanschluß extern oder vom C64? Extern über Schaltnetzteil
6. ATMega32 oder ATMega644? ATMega 1284P
7. Bootloader ja/nein? Ja
8. Verhalten der LEDs beim Einschalten (bitte genau beschreiben)?
11. Welcher Kernal wird im C64 verwendet (Original, Jiffy, etc)? Jiffy, aber auch im original Kernal
12. Wird ein Expansionsportmodul verwendet (z.B. FCIII)? Nein
13. Ist ein Multimeter/Durchgangsprüfer vorhanden? Ja
14. Externer Quartz installiert oder nicht? Ja
16. auf welche ID ist das gerät eingestellt (8/9/10 etc) 8
So und nun das Verhalten:
Ich habe mir ein Gehäuse gebaut, in dem sich ein Schaltnetzteil für die 5V, ein Trafo für die
9V, das sd2iec und ein Umschalter befindet.
(siehe Bild)
Die Stromversorgung des sd2iec kommt von dem Schaltnetzteil.
Oben links sieht man den IEC-Eingang, welcher vom C64 kommt.
Rechts daneben der Ausgang, da hängt das Wiesemann-Interface dran.
Mit dem Umschalter kann ich nun zwischen sd2iec und Wiesemann hin- und herschalten.
Im ersten Fall hängt nun das sd2iec direkt am C64, im zweiten, das Wiesemann.
Geschaltet werden die Leitungen Data, ATN und Clock, diese habe ich am sd2iec über 4,7kOhm-
Widerstände an 5V liegen.
Nun zum Verhalten:
Beim Einschalten der Spannung geht die grüne LED für ca. 1,5s an und dann aus.
Danach schalte ich den C64 an und dasselbe passiert nochmal.
Manchmal funktioniert alles dann so, wie's soll, aber manchmal eben auch nicht.
Wenn ich dann das directory laden will, steht dann: "searching for $" und es tut sich nix mehr.
LEDs gehen auch nicht an, sd2iec lässt sich auch nich in den Sleep-Modus versetzen.
Zuerst dachte ich mir, da fehlen die Pullup-Widerstände(hatte ich zuerst bicht dran).
Das war's aber nicht. Als ich dann mal das sd2iec resettet habe ging's dann wieder.
So, ich hoffe, ich hab's mal genau genug beschrieben, so dass ihr was damit anfangen könnt...